The win is Ferrum Head Coach Bill Tharp's first collegiate coaching victory. The Senators are an NCAA Division II program, competing in the West Virginia Intercollegiate Athletic Conference.
Ford was 6-11 from the floor, including 1-1 from behind the arc, and went 6-7 from the line. He hauled in six rebounds in 27 minutes of play.
Junior forward Keith Harris had 12 points on 4-8 shooting to go with six rebounds and four assists. Freshman forward added 10 points in the win.
Davis & Elkins was led by Alex Hawkins, who had 12 points, and Bobby Alexander, who had 11. The Senators remain winless with the loss at 0-5. Ferrum improves to 1-4, and will be back in action Saturday, Dec. 3, at NCAA Division I opponent High Point University in High Point, North Carolina.
